The Flood Advisory continues for
  The Cumberland River At Nashville
* Until this afternoon.
* At 03AM Tuesday the stage was 31.8 feet...and falling.
* Action stage is 30 feet.
* Flood stage is 40.0 feet.
* The river will continue to fall to near 27.0 feet by tomorrow morning.
* At 32.0 feet...Further inundation of low lying areas along the river is
  occurring including the riverfront landing and receation areas near Nissan
  Stadium.
* At 30.0 feet...Water reaches the first grassy area of the riverfront landing,
  and the access point on the east side of the river near Nissan Stadium.
* At 25.0 feet...The riverfront recreation areas on both sides of the river
  begin to be inundated.
